数字记录仪误差分析的快速方法
Fast method of error analysis for digitizer
【摘要】 为确定数字记录仪的测量误差,提出了一种动态特性校验的快速方法。校验采用正弦波作为输入信号,用相关法和最小二乘法分步求得输出数据的拟合波形,同时准确测定输入信号的幅值。这样,可方便地确定输出数据的分散性和动态刻度系数,从而可全面地分析数字记录仪的随机误差和系统误差。文中给出了数字记录仪的实际校验结果,并讨论了测量误差的变化规律。
【Abstract】 n order to determine errors in measurement by digitizer, a fast method ofdynamic performance test is presented. In the test, sine wave signal is taken as the input,the fitted waveform of output data is obtained by means of the correlative method and theleast square method respectively, and in the meantime the amplitude of input signal ismeasured accurately. Thus, the dispersity of output data and the dynamic scale factor can beeasily determined, and then random and systematic errors of digitizers can be all--sidedlyanalyzed. The results of practical tests for a digitizer are given, and the variation patterns oferrors in measurement are discussed.
